Why Coated Metal is Replacing FRP Duct on Wastewater Odor Control Systems

Wastewater treatment plants are discovering a superior odor control exhaust duct technology which delivers significant cost savings and fire safety to the facility.

With increasing pressure on wastewater treatment plants to control odors, Fab-Tech is seeing increased interest in applying its technology to lower costs and improve performance and safety in WWTP odor control applications.

This technology has been widely adopted by the semiconductor industry to handle highly corrosive process fume exhaust and is now being deployed in the wastewater treatment industry to improve foul air containment, reduce construction cost, eliminate maintenance costs, and improve worker and fire safety vs FRP Duct.
